Economic crisis in Sri Lanka- State of emergency enforced throughout the island and security tighten in several places based on the intelligence received

The President has issued a special gazette notification enforcing the state of emergency throughout the island.

 The Department of Government Information stated that the state of emergency will be declared island wide from April 01 (yesterday) as per the gazette notification issued by the President.

The statement said the move was in line with the powers vested in the President under the Public Security Act to ensure public safety and the well-being of the country, as well as to ensure the continuation of essential supplies and services to the lives of the people, in the event of a public emergency in the country.

Meanwhile,the Ministry of Public Security says that steps have been taken to tighten security in several places based on the intelligence received.

Retired Rear Admiral Dr. Sarath Weerasekera, Minister of Public Defense said that the relevant departments have been instructed to take necessary steps in this regard.

 The Minister stated that he respects the constitutional of the people to protest peacefully.

However, the Minister of Public Defense, retired Rear Admiral Dr. Sarath Weerasekera has stated that the law will be enforced against those who act in a manner that damage public property.

Also, The curfew imposed on all police areas in the Western Province from 12.00 midnight yesterday (01) was lifted at 6.00 am today (02), the Police Media Spokesman’s Office stated.
